Surnames Frequency by Census Records

  1. KULLAR

    According to the U.S. Census Bureau, Kullar is ranked #113155 in terms of the most common surnames in America.

    The Kullar surname appeared 155 times in the 2010 census and if you were to sample 100,000 people in the United States, approximately 0 would have the surname Kullar.

    87.1% or 135 total occurrences were Asian.
    8.3% or 13 total occurrences were White.
